Output 653327c547d51b55872564aaa65b02e407b61b7c87ff37e32e4c02c9be0a6f18:54

value
23538345275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b7345bbf68e5980b6ceb29460d3aa8f87da6b1b OP_EQUAL
address
MBruNwoJJau6Z2nUJ21n5PZc8eLGcfi53N
transaction
653327c547d51b55872564aaa65b02e407b61b7c87ff37e32e4c02c9be0a6f18
spent
true